What is a GED in Spanish math instructor?

GED in Spanish Math Instructors are educators who specialize in teaching math concepts and skills in Spanish to students preparing for the General Educational Development (GED) exam. They help Spanish-speaking learners understand the math topics covered on the GED, such as algebra, geometry, and basic arithmetic. These instructors use bilingual teaching strategies to ensure students grasp the material and are prepared to pass the math section of the GED test. Their goal is to bridge language barriers and support adult learners in achieving their educational goals.

What are some common challenges faced by GED in Spanish math instructors and how can they be addressed?

GED in Spanish Math Instructors often encounter challenges such as addressing varying levels of math proficiency among students and overcoming language barriers in explaining complex mathematical concepts. To address these, instructors typically use differentiated instruction techniques, visual aids, and real-world examples to make lessons more accessible. Collaborating with other educators and utilizing bilingual resources can also help ensure that students feel supported and engaged. Building a supportive classroom environment where students are encouraged to ask questions is key to their success.

Position Summary
Mathnasium of Granger is looking for an exceptional Lead Math Instructor to create an engaging and productive learning experience for students. Lead Math Instructors must effectively balance leadership and instructional responsibilities by providing exceptional customer service, ensuring students are making academic progress, and coaching instructors on instruction and student engagement.
The ideal candidate is a bright, passionate, and dedicated professional with excellent interpersonal, mathematical, instructional, and leadership skills. This opportunity presents the right candidate a unique career path focused on helping the community, working with students, and inspiring team members, as well as a rich experience developing professional skills.
All applicants are required to take a math literacy test to demonstrate math proficiency, provide work authorization, and pass a background check. Following hiring, the new team member is required to complete training in the Mathnasium Method™. This is a part-time role with flexible hours.
Job Responsibilities
  • Provide exceptional instruction/tutoring services to students
  • Teach in-person, online, and/or via hybrid delivery using the Mathnasium Method™, terminology, and teaching practices which include individualized instruction in a group setting
  • Become proficient with digital educational materials & processes
  • Assess students’ progress throughout instructional sessions and ensure students are focused, not distracting others, and have been checked on regularly
  • Evaluate, grade, and correct student work and homework
  • Mentor, coach, and work collaboratively with team members to deliver the best possible experience for students
  • Participate in positive interactions with parents and establish a high level of confidence and program value
  • Support the maintenance of a clean & professional learning environment
  • Assist with non-teaching/instructional tasks as needed
Qualifications
  • A passion for math and working with students
  • Exceptional math competency through at least Algebra I
  • Excellent interpersonal skills
  • Ability to balance various ongoing tasks 
  • Willingness to learn and be trained
